I put together a quick prototype to test this out - this is what it looks like with fuse having a generic iomap interface that supports dax [1], and the famfs custom logic moved to a bpf program [2]. I didn't change much, I just moved around your famfs code to the bpf side. The kernel side changes are in [3] and the libfuse changes are in [4]. For testing out the prototype, I hooked it up to passthrough_hp to test running the bpf program and verify that it is able to find the extent from the bpf map. In my opinion, this makes the fuse side infrastructure cleaner and more extendable for other servers that will want to go through dax iomap in the future, but I think this also has a few benefits for famfs. Instead of needing to issue a FUSE_GET_FMAP request after a file is opened, the server can directly populate the metadata map from userspace with the mapping info when it processes the FUSE_OPEN request, which gets rid of the roundtrip cost. The server can dynamically update the metadata at any time from userspace if the mapping info needs to change in the future. For setting up the daxdevs, I moved your logic to the init side, where the server passes the daxdev info upfront through an IOMAP_CONFIG exchange with the kernel initializing the daxdevs based off that info. I think this will also make deploying future updates for famfs easier, as updating the logic won't need to go through the upstream kernel mailing list process and deploying updates won't require a new kernel release. These are just my two cents based on my (cursory) understanding of famfs. Just wanted to float this alternative approach in case it's useful.
